Hello, I have no kitchen for the week. I've got an airfryer on the living room floor to see us through. Has anyone got any ideas for easy, no prep meals that I can cook in the fryer?

So far, I've boiled eggs in it, I've reheated left over takeaway, cooked, sausages and I've done freezer meals like nuggets and chips. My son is very happy.

Any suggestions? It's a double basket fryer. Thanks.

Hereallweek · 15/04/2024 13:16

Chicken breast cooks really well in an air fryer, stays moist and doesn't smell much either. Shred into wraps with salad? Add BBQ sauce and serve with mixed roasted veg as above? Add some spanish-seasoned passata and microwave rice for the last couple of minutes of cooking?

Ratfan24 · 15/04/2024 13:29

Not sure if your DS would like it but Salmon comes out nice in the airfryer takes about 12 mins for a fillet. I sometimes do it with soy and honey and a little sesame oil drizzled over. Serve with some rice and cucumber salad.
